Principal Full Stack Engineer I Job in Connectwise
Principal Full Stack Engineer I
- Bengaluru, Bangalore Urban, Karnataka
- Not Disclosed
- Full-time
- Permanent
Job Description The Principal Full Stack Engineer II is responsible for developing high-quality, innovative, fully performing software in compliance with coding standards. This individual works in partnership with cross-functional teams to ensure that software deliverables, including designs, codes, and tests, are completed in a timely manner, while remaining aligned with industry and organizational standards. Essential Duties & Responsibilities: Provides support to cross-functional teams, with a high attention to detail Researches, analyzes, and documents findings May coach and review the work of other team members Designs, modifies, writes, and implements front-end code for software programming applications Oversees development projects from requirement documentation to delivery Defines project scope with stakeholder, creates acceptance criteria, coordinates with project manager, and manages change control throughout the course of development projects Develops and maintains common controls library Evaluates codes to ensure validity, proper structure, alignment with industry standards, and compatibility with operating systems Maintains an understanding of current technologies or programming practices through continuing education, reading or participation in professional conferences, workshops, or Job Requirement Knowledge, Skills, and/or Abilities Required: Ability to manage projects and processes independently with limited supervision Ability to situationally adapt and understand new technology/processes as per business requirement Must be proficient in Python, Django, Postgres, MySQL, Golang,React,angular Able to conceptualize and design high-quality product features Ability to coach and mentor team members Passionate about learning new technologies and working across varied tech stacks. Hands-on development experience in monolith, web services, web APIs, message queues, and microservices architecture. Candidates should have designed products on AWS or any other public cloud. Should have experience in enterprise applications on cloud or on-premise environments. Has delivered multiple versions of a SaaS-based product to production. Strong proponent of engineering best practices for Unit Testing, Coverage, Code Quality, Continuous Integration & Continuous Deployment. Should be able to communicate with platform and cross-functional teams. Good working knowledge of supporting tools like version control (e.g., GIT Repositories) and Docker. Educational/Vocational/Previous Experience Recommendations: Bachelor s degree in Computer Science/ECE-related field or equivalent experience 9+ years of relevant experience
Fresher
2 - 4 Hires